Manawatu District covers 2,566.59 km 2 (990.97 sq mi) [1] and had an estimated population of 34,800 as of June 2024, [2] with a density of 13.6 people per km 2. Feilding, the council seat, has a population of 18,250, the only town with more than 1,000.

Manawatū-Whanganui [5] ([manawaˈtʉː ˈʔwaŋanʉi]; spelled Manawatu-Wanganui prior to 2019) is a region in the lower half of the North Island of New Zealand, whose main population centres are the cities of Palmerston North and Whanganui.
